HAIMER MILL - F2004NN Chamfer
Solid carbide end mill
Quality pass
Shank tolerance h6
Runout < 0.0004" (10 µm)
Universal solid carbide end mill for a broad range of applications
  • Shank tolerance: h6
  • Neck for higher cutting depth
  • Center cutting
  • Unequal cutting edge
  • Unequal Helix
  • Runout < 10 µm
  • For almost all materials
  • For roughing and finishing
  • For ramping, drilling and slotting
HAIMER TIP
Cooling with Cool Jet or Cool Flash and using Power Chucks is recommended for higher tool life and high removal rate.

AREAS OF APPLICATION - MATERIAL
MAIN AREA OF APPLICATION
 P
Steel
All types of steel and cast steel, with the exception of steel with an austenitic structure
P
  M
Stainless steel
Stainless austenitic steel and austenitic-ferritic steel and cast steel
M
FURTHER AREAS OF APPLICATION
 K
Cast iron
Grey cast iron, cast iron with spheroidal graphite, malleable cast iron, cast iron with vermicular graphite
K
 S
High temperature alloys and titanium alloys
Heat resisting special alloys based on iron, nickel and cobalt, titanium and titanium alloys
S
 N
NF metals
Aluminium and other non-ferrous metals, non ferrous materials
N
 H
Hard materials
Hardened steel, hardened cast iron materials, chilled cast iron
H
